Description

This module rexposes wrapped parsers from the GHC API. Along with returning the parse result, the corresponding annotations are also returned such that it is then easy to modify the annotations and print the result.

Module Parsers

parseModule :: FilePath -> IO (Either (SrcSpan, String) (Anns, ParsedSource)) Source #

This entry point will also work out which language extensions are required and perform CPP processing if necessary.

parseModule = parseModuleWithCpp defaultCppOptions

Note: ParsedSource is a synonym for Located (HsModule RdrName)

parseModuleFromString :: FilePath -> String -> IO (Either (SrcSpan, String) (Anns, ParsedSource)) Source #

This entry point will work out which language extensions are required but will _not_ perform CPP processing. In contrast to parseModoule the input source is read from the provided string; the FilePath parameter solely exists to provide a name in source location annotations.

parseModuleWithCpp :: CppOptions -> DeltaOptions -> FilePath -> IO (Either (SrcSpan, String) (Anns, ParsedSource)) Source #

Parse a module with specific instructions for the C pre-processor.

Basic Parsers

parseWith :: Annotate w => DynFlags -> FilePath -> P (Located w) -> String -> Either (SrcSpan, String) (Anns, Located w) Source #

Wrapper function which returns Annotations along with the parsed element.

Internal

parseModuleApiAnnsWithCpp :: CppOptions -> FilePath -> IO (Either (SrcSpan, String) (ApiAnns, [Comment], DynFlags, ParsedSource)) Source #

Low level function which is used in the internal tests. It is advised to use parseModule or parseModuleWithCpp instead of this function.
